| Newbie Join Date: Oct 2007 | Here are some pics of my droid, Used it this weekend at a T.A.W game,( underworld) right out of the box it was +-2 at 275. I was able to shoot 2420 shots off my 114/4500 at 4000 psi, and i ran out of paint still had 850psi left in the tank.I let my teamate shoot it and ran out of paint and still had 50 psi in the tank and there was no drop off when he came off the field. i was really impressed with the marker and barrel. ![]() ![]() ![]() |
